Introduction to Refrigerator Cooling Systems
Before we dive into the reasons why your fridge might be hot on the side, it’s crucial to have a basic understanding of how refrigerators work. Refrigerators operate on a simple principle: they transfer heat from the inside of the fridge to the outside. This process is achieved through a refrigeration cycle that involves the compressor, condenser coils, expansion valve, and evaporator coils. The compressor compresses the refrigerant, which then moves to the condenser coils where it releases heat to the surrounding air. The condensed refrigerant then passes through the expansion valve, which reduces its pressure, allowing it to absorb heat from the inside of the fridge in the evaporator coils.

Possible Causes for a Hot Fridge Side
Now that we’ve covered the basics of how refrigerators work and the importance of proper installation, let’s explore the possible causes for why your brand new fridge might be hot on the side:
A significant factor could be the condenser coils located at the back or bottom of the fridge. These coils are responsible for dissipating the heat generated during the refrigeration cycle. If the coils are dirty, clogged, or not functioning correctly, they can cause the fridge to overheat. Regular cleaning of the condenser coils is recommended to ensure they operate efficiently.
Another possible cause is poor airflow around the fridge. If the appliance is placed too close to walls or other obstacles, it can restrict airflow and prevent the efficient dissipation of heat. Ensuring that there is enough clearance around the fridge, as specified by the manufacturer, can help mitigate this issue.
Additionally, internal factors such as a malfunctioning compressor, issues with the refrigerant level, or problems with the evaporator fan can also cause the fridge to become hot on the side. These issues often require professional attention to diagnose and repair.

How can I check if my fridge’s condenser coils are blocked or dirty?
To check if your fridge’s condenser coils are blocked or dirty, you’ll need to locate them first. Typically, they’re found at the back or bottom of the fridge, and may be protected by a cover or grille. Once you’ve located the coils, inspect them for any signs of blockage or dirt accumulation. Check for dust, pet hair, or other debris that may be obstructing the coils’ airflow. You can use a flashlight to illuminate the area and a soft-bristled brush or vacuum cleaner to gently remove any debris. It’s also a good idea to check the coil’s fins for any bends or damage, as this can also impede airflow.
If you find that your coils are blocked or dirty, clean them thoroughly using a soft-bristled brush or vacuum cleaner. For more severe blockages, you may need to use a garden hose to gently spray the coils and remove any stubborn debris. Once you’ve cleaned the coils, inspect them again to ensure they’re free from obstructions. It’s also a good idea to check the fridge’s user manual for specific guidance on coil maintenance and cleaning. Regular cleaning of the condenser coils can help maintain your fridge’s optimal performance, reduce energy consumption, and prevent overheating issues.

How can I check if my fridge’s doors are sealing properly, and what are the consequences of poor sealing?
To check if your fridge’s doors are sealing properly, you can perform a simple test using a piece of paper or a dollar bill. Place the paper or bill between the door and the frame, then close the door. If the paper or bill is held in place tightly, the seal is good. If it falls out or can be easily pulled out, the seal may be compromised. You can also inspect the door gaskets for any signs of wear, damage, or misalignment. Poor sealing can lead to warm air entering the fridge, causing the cooling system to work harder and generating more heat.
Poor sealing can have significant consequences, including increased energy consumption, reduced fridge performance, and potentially even food spoilage. If the doors are not sealing properly, warm air can enter the fridge, causing the temperature to rise and the cooling system to work overtime. This can lead to increased energy bills and reduced fridge lifespan. Additionally, poor sealing can also allow moisture to enter the fridge, leading to condensation and potential mold growth. To address poor sealing, you can try adjusting the door alignment, replacing the door gaskets, or tightening any loose screws or hinges. If the issue persists, it’s recommended to consult a professional appliance technician for further assistance.
